Lemon Grass Herb
Latin Name: Cymbopogon citratus
Common Name: Lemongrass
Family: Poaceae
Growing Region: Asia, Central America
Description: Lemon Grass Herb is typically supplied cut and sifted, displaying pale green to straw-colored fibrous pieces with a strong citrus aroma. It is widely used in tea blends, extracts, culinary applications, and botanical formulations, traditionally incorporated into products supporting digestive comfort and refreshing wellness blends.
